Is your child's development on track?

Typical Child Development


Babies are born learning. Your child's most rapid development occurs from birth through his or her third birthday. The rst three years set the stage for a lifetime of learning.

SO, is your child on track? Complete this developmental checklist to nd out...


By 3 months
Sucks and swallows well during feeding Reaches and grasps for things with hands Lifts & holds head up

By 15 months
May use 3 to 10 words Has temper tantrums when frustrated Walks alone and seldom falls

By 6 months
Begins to use consonant and vowel combinations Rolls from back to tummy Reaches for a nearby toy while on tummy

By 18 months
May combine simple words Enjoys pretend play games-or dances to music Drinks from a cup and uses a spoon or fork

By 9 months
Looks at familiar objects and people when named Sits without support Creeps and pull self up

By 24 months
Uses two to three word sentences Names several body parts Throws a ball overhand and kicks ball forward

By 12 months
Responds to simple instructions -sit down Plays social games such as pat-a-cake & peek-a-boo Pulls to stand and cruises along furniture

By 36 months
May know up to 200 words in their home language Puts own shirt, but needs help w/ shoes and buttons More than 50 percent of childs speech is understood
